From Saturday, the government says people who live alone will be able to form a “support bubble” with another household.

New guidance states that they will be allowed to scrap social distancing and stay overnight away from their own home in England.

The Health Protection Regulations, which allow police to enforce lockdown conditions, are being rewritten for a fourth time to take account of the change.
